I'm a huge EF fan but I would stay away from the 42% Extra unless you're strictly looking to do imac. Especially if it's an early version with the pocket hinges. I had one and even did a build thread on it and IMO it couldn't 3D to save its life. Snap and roll start/stops were mushy, rolls were slow, all control authority went away at low air speeds.. The newer version with the conventional hinges is probably a lot better but I have no experience with it.

The 35% EF Extra 300 is a fricken rock star though...best EF plane/35% plane I've ever had. Sounds like you found your deal with that 37% yak and DLE anyway.
